Hi Marek — handing off the Corvid broker upgrade before I'm out. We're moving from 3.8 to 4.1; the staging cluster is already on it and has been stable for a week. Main gotchas: the quorum-queue migration script must run before the rolling restart, and the old mirroring policy needs deleting or the nodes refuse to rejoin. Review focus should be the failover tests in the PR — they're new. I wrote up the full upgrade sequence and rollback plan here:

operations page: https://jenkins.zemvarcloud.local/job/merge_requests/repo/build/73930b4b30f0a8ed

Subject: Key rotation for Pairwise profiler access

Hi all — quick heads-up before the eng sync. While digging into the GC pauses in the Pairwise matching service (those 800 ms stalls during peak), we rotated the profiler service key as part of the cleanup. Old key dies Friday. Grab traces with the new one, which is pasted below.

service key, tadup-tahog: zpat7_wB1tnEL

Hi,

Quick summary from yesterday's disaster-recovery drill for the Restockr vending-machine restock planner. Failover to the Marrowfield standby region completed in 14 minutes; route optimization resumed cleanly, but the inventory snapshot restore needed manual intervention. That's the part touching the branch you're reviewing — please check the restore path handles a sealed snapshot store. To reproduce the drill locally, you'll need to unseal the snapshot fixture, which requires the recovery passphrase below.

strongbox words: zorwyn-sorael-belion-ulaius-silmir-ulays-briax-rusdor-gorix

09:41 — Build agents in the Strathmoor pool drifted roughly 47 seconds apart after an NTP daemon crash, causing artifact timestamps to appear out of order and the Kellridge cache to reject valid entries. Mira restarted time sync fleet-wide and invalidated affected cache keys. The remediation build is recorded under the token below.

session token of bawep-yadup = htk21_528abd376e3c5a4ec24a1